Listing last updated on May 6, 2016

Upcoming Events

Contact Information

Contact:

(415) 386-8332
Location:
439 Balboa St
San Francisco, CA 94118
Mailing Address:
439 Balboa St
San Francisco, CA 94118

Coming Events

No Events on File

See all events for this area...